8 grueling months after I placed my original PTS order for a Champagne Yellow Posche C4S Cab and after Porsche denied that color and the replacement they suggested Jonquil Yellow , my Turquoise Blue one got here.

Why Turquiose Blue you ask! The answer is obvious. After my first two colors were a no-go I started looking for another PTS on the internet and low and behold I came across Edgy's (Dan's) beautiful car. We traded a few e-mails and he was generous enough not to mind me duplicating his awesome car so that's what I did! Thank you Dan!

I picked it up on Friday morning and I was away all weekend and just got back now. Man, I'm in heaven. I love this color! I usually lease mine for 3 or 4 years but this is my last Porsche for sure. After the lease is up I'll buy it....no doubt....I could never turn this one back in.

I can't wipe the smile off my face and at 62 there's not many feelings as good as this. It's stunning to drive to....quick as hell and tight as hell. The Nav system is wonderful as is the interface for the IPOD and the bluetooth.

Anyway, guys, I know the color isn't everyone's cup of tea but it sure is mine........what'dya think
